Q: What is TC1107-2.8VOA? A: TC1107-2.8VOA is a voltage output adjustable low dropout (LDO) regulator with a fixed output voltage of 2.8V.
Q: What is the typical input voltage range for TC1107-2.8VOA? A: The typical input voltage range for TC1107-2.8VOA is between 2.5V and 6.0V.
Q: How much maximum output current can TC1107-2.8VOA provide? A: TC1107-2.8VOA can provide a maximum output current of 100mA.
Q: Can TC1107-2.8VOA be used in battery-powered applications? A: Yes, TC1107-2.8VOA is suitable for battery-powered applications due to its low quiescent current and low dropout voltage.
Q: What is the dropout voltage of TC1107-2.8VOA? A: The dropout voltage of TC1107-2.8VOA is typically 200mV at 100mA load current.
Q: Is TC1107-2.8VOA stable with ceramic capacitors? A: Yes, TC1107-2.8VOA is designed to be stable with ceramic capacitors, which makes it suitable for space-constrained designs.
Q: Can TC1107-2.8VOA handle short-circuit conditions? A: Yes, TC1107-2.8VOA has built-in current limit and thermal shutdown protection, which allows it to handle short-circuit conditions.
Q: What is the operating temperature range for TC1107-2.8VOA? A: The operating temperature range for TC1107-2.8VOA is typically -40°C to +125°C.
Q: Does TC1107-2.8VOA require any external components for operation? A: Yes, TC1107-2.8VOA requires a minimum of two external capacitors (input and output) for stable operation.
